Why Use a Dog Feeding Mat?


The primary purpose of a dog feeding mat is to keep your dog's eating area clean. We all love our furry friends, but let’s face it they can be messy eaters. A feeding mat catches crumbs, spills, and dribbled water, preventing them from staining your floors. Plus, it offers a defined space for your dog, helping them understand where to eat, which can be particularly beneficial for training puppies.


Choosing the Right Feeding Mat


When selecting a feeding mat, consider its material. Silicone and rubber are popular choices due to their non-slip surfaces, ensuring the mat stays in place while your dog eats. Additionally, these materials are generally waterproof, making cleanup a breeze. Some mats even come with raised edges to further contain spills. If style is a concern, many pet feeding mats come in various colors and designs, allowing you to choose one that complements your home décor.

The Puzzle of Size and Shape


Feeding mats come in different shapes and sizes, catering to various breeds and feeding styles. For smaller dogs, a compact mat may suffice, while larger breeds might require a more substantial option. Additionally, consider whether you feed your dog in a bowl or a raised feeder; the mat should accommodate both. It’s essential to measure your space and your dog’s feeding setup to ensure a perfect fit.
